27.11.2013 / 14:04 | |
samodelkin Пользователь Сейчас: Offline
Имя: Сергей Откуда: Липецк Регистрация: 05.11.2013
| Xml файлы в порядке, выкладываю код классов.
Изменено samodelkin (27.11 / 14:05) (всего 2 раза) |
27.11.2013 / 14:56 | |
samodelkin Пользователь Сейчас: Offline
Имя: Сергей Откуда: Липецк Регистрация: 05.11.2013
| Не успел выложить- сайт не давал ответа браузеру, прошло 20минут- уже научился рисовать на канве, но все таки обьясните почему при показе второй Активности из главной при нажатии на кнопку "назад" приложение сразу закрывается?
|
27.11.2013 / 15:16 | |
samodelkin Пользователь Сейчас: Offline
Имя: Сергей Откуда: Липецк Регистрация: 05.11.2013
| Точнее из первой активности показываю xml-файл, который создался вместе со второй активностью(R.id.main_activity2), а из второй активности показываю xml-файл, создавшийся вместе с первой активностью(R.id.main_activity1), скажите пожайлуста что я не так делаю?
Изменено samodelkin (27.11 / 15:18) (всего 2 раза) |
27.11.2013 / 15:34 | |
Its_Your_Soul Пользователь Сейчас: Offline
Имя: Саша Откуда: Винница Регистрация: 29.08.2012
| samodelkin, Код в студию !
|
27.11.2013 / 15:54 | |
samodelkin Пользователь Сейчас: Offline
Имя: Сергей Откуда: Липецк Регистрация: 05.11.2013
| Вообщем у меня в первой активности показывался ее layout, а при нажатии на элемент показывался layout второй активности, и все делалось с помощью setContentView(id), а я думал что setContentView показывает вторую активность, чего на самом деле не было, а решил проблему с помощью команды startActivity(intent) , которую вызвал из первой активности для показа второй, и при нажатии на кнопку "назад" вторая активность закрылась.
|
27.11.2013 / 15:55 | |
samodelkin Пользователь Сейчас: Offline
Имя: Сергей Откуда: Липецк Регистрация: 05.11.2013
| Вообщем сегодня научился переключаться между активностями и работать в канвасе.
|
27.11.2013 / 16:55 | |
Naik Пользователь Сейчас: Offline
Имя: %name% Регистрация: 14.03.2010
| samodelkin, вообщем тебе с такими вопросами на startandroid.ru
|
27.11.2013 / 16:58 | |
samodelkin Пользователь Сейчас: Offline
Имя: Сергей Откуда: Липецк Регистрация: 05.11.2013
| Naik, уже успел создать после обеда там одну тему.
Изменено samodelkin (27.11 / 16:58) (всего 1 раз) |
27.11.2013 / 16:58 | |
Naik Пользователь Сейчас: Offline
Имя: %name% Регистрация: 14.03.2010
| samodelkin, не темы надо создавать, а уроки читать |
28.11.2013 / 07:12 | |
samodelkin Пользователь Сейчас: Offline
Имя: Сергей Откуда: Липецк Регистрация: 05.11.2013
| Имеется канва, в которой происходит рисование надписи, и при нажатии на сенсорный экран координата "игрек", по которой надпись рисуется должна принимать значение "игрек" нажатого сенсора, но при нажатии почему-то надпись остается на своем месте, подскажите что неверно?
import android.content.Context; import android.view.MotionEvent; import android.view.View; import android.view.View.OnTouchListener; import android.graphics.*;
public class Canva extends View{ private int y; public Canva(Context context) { super(context); this.setOnTouchListener(otl); y=0; } protected void onDraw(Canvas canvas){ super.onDraw(canvas); Paint paint = new Paint(); paint.setStyle(Paint.Style.FILL); // закрашиваем холст белым цветом paint.setColor(Color.BLACK); canvas.drawPaint(paint); paint.setColor(Color.WHITE); canvas.drawText("Привет, Android",30,y, paint); } OnTouchListener otl= new OnTouchListener() { public boolean onTouch(View v,MotionEvent event) { y=(int)event.getY(); return true; } }; }
Изменено samodelkin (28.11 / 07:13) (всего 2 раза) |